Which doesn't explain why many of the Drive-Ins in CA (like the one near
Knott-so-Merry Farm) are abandoned lots. 

In fact, there is a whole scene being built around using the lot and old
screen with a portable projector, a generator, and low power FM
transmitter. For some folks, we have come full circle - the movie
cinemas that outdid the drive-in with their stadium seating, THX sound
and 26" wide cupholders have become too greedy for their own good:
